### Python Requirements
2023-08-20 20:08:30 -07:00
To ingest basic metadata sqlite user must have the following privileges:
2023-04-25 16:58:47 +02:00
- `SELECT` Privilege on `sqlite_temp_master`

### 1. Define the YAML Config
This is a sample config for SQLite:
{% codePreview %}
{% codeInfoContainer %}
#### Source Configuration - Service Connection
{% codeInfo srNumber=1 %}
**username**: Username to connect to SQLite. Blank for in-memory database.
{% /codeInfo %}
{% codeInfo srNumber=2 %}
**password**: Password to connect to SQLite. Blank for in-memory database.
{% /codeInfo %}
{% codeInfo srNumber=3 %}
**hostPort**: Enter the hostname and port number for your SQLite deployment in the Host and Port field.
{% /codeInfo %}
{% codeInfo srNumber=4 %}
**database**: The database of the data source is an optional parameter, if you would like to restrict the metadata reading to a single database. If left blank, OpenMetadata ingestion attempts to scan all the databases.
{% /codeInfo %}
{% codeInfo srNumber=5 %}
**databaseMode**: How to run the SQLite database. :memory: by default.
{% /codeInfo %}
